在之前的推文里面也給大家介紹了JPEGLS算法的一些內(nèi)容,可以點(diǎn)擊下方鏈接查看JPEGLS算法簡(jiǎn)介
現(xiàn)在來(lái)看一下GitHub上面一個(gè)開(kāi)源的JPEG LS算法的Verilog實(shí)現(xiàn)
開(kāi)源地址:https://github.com/WangXuan95/FPGA-JPEG-LS-encoder
項(xiàng)目介紹
基于 FPGA 的流式的 JPEG-LS 圖像壓縮器,特點(diǎn)是:
純 Verilog 設(shè)計(jì),可在各種FPGA型號(hào)上部署
用于壓縮 8bit 的灰度圖像。
可選無(wú)損模式,即 NEAR=0 。
可選有損模式,NEAR=1~7 可調(diào)。
圖像寬度取值范圍為 [5,16384],高度取值范圍為 [1,16384]。
極簡(jiǎn)流式輸入輸出。
使用方法
RTL 目錄中的 jls_encoder.v 是用戶(hù)可以調(diào)用的 JPEG-LS 壓縮模塊,它輸入圖像原始像素,輸出 JPEG-LS 壓縮流。
模塊參數(shù)
jls_encoder 只有一個(gè)參數(shù):決定了 NEAR 值,取值為 3'd0 時(shí),工作在無(wú)損模式;取值為 3'd1~3'd7 時(shí),工作在有損模式。
parameter[2:0]NEAR
流程

資源消耗

-
FPGA
+關(guān)注
關(guān)注
1650文章
22217瀏覽量
628041 -
算法
+關(guān)注
關(guān)注
23文章
4743瀏覽量
96903 -
Verilog
+關(guān)注
關(guān)注
30文章
1369瀏覽量
113819 -
壓縮器
+關(guān)注
關(guān)注
0文章
28瀏覽量
8133
原文標(biāo)題:FPGA開(kāi)源項(xiàng)目介紹---圖像壓縮
文章出處:【微信號(hào):FPGA開(kāi)源工坊,微信公眾號(hào):FPGA開(kāi)源工坊】歡迎添加關(guān)注!文章轉(zhuǎn)載請(qǐng)注明出處。
發(fā)布評(píng)論請(qǐng)先 登錄
基于DSP的JPEG圖像壓縮設(shè)計(jì)
基于JPEG標(biāo)準(zhǔn)的靜態(tài)圖像壓縮算法研究
壓縮文件可以使用pdf壓縮器嗎
如何使用pdf壓縮器把文件進(jìn)行壓縮
靜止圖像壓縮標(biāo)準(zhǔn)JPEG IP核的設(shè)計(jì)與實(shí)現(xiàn)
基于DSP的圖像采集及JPEG-LS壓縮系統(tǒng)
基于FPGA的靜止圖像壓縮系統(tǒng)的研究
基于FPGA的JPEG實(shí)時(shí)圖像編解碼系統(tǒng)
達(dá)芬奇技術(shù)的JPEG2000圖像壓縮系統(tǒng)設(shè)計(jì)
圖像壓縮加密算法
JPEG 2000圖像壓縮的優(yōu)勢(shì)介紹
如何使用FPGA實(shí)現(xiàn)機(jī)載圖像無(wú)損和近無(wú)損壓縮方案

基于FPGA的JPEG-LS圖像壓縮器介紹
評(píng)論